Summerville Real Estate agent and Republican Candidate for State Representative, Betty Brady has collected over $5,000 in campaign contributions from Republican State Sentors.

According to the figures released by the Secretary of State’s office, Brady received $4,600 from Republican Senator Eric Johnson of Savannah and $750 from Republican Senator Preston Smith of Rome.

Brady also received substantial contributions from Summerville Attorney Sam Finster and a local resident. 

Brady is seeking to un-seat 11th District Democrat Barbara Massey-Reece in the General Election in November.  The 11th District covers all of Chattooga County and a portion of rural Floyd County.
